PCOM Opportunities Academy
Philadelphia Summer STEM Program
Philadelphia area high school student participants have the opportunity to explore
careers in healthcare while building relationships with PCOM faculty and medical student
mentors.
The Opportunities Academy will be held June 20-24, 2022, at PCOM's Philadelphia campus on City Avenue. This program is available to Philadelphia area high school students
at no cost.

About our STEM program
Students will participate in clinical skills simulations in the Saltzburg Clinical Learning and Assessment Center, visit the anatomy lab, participate in heart and brain anatomy labs, learn CPR and
more. Additionally, participants will learn about the college application process
as well as build networks with physicians, physician assistants, pharmacists, physical
therapists, counselors, psychologists and other healthcare professionals.

How to apply
Apply online today. Applications are due Friday, April 29, 2022. High school students applying to the program will provide a short personal statement
about their future career goals and at least one teacher recommendation.
